Michael Watzek commented on JDO-311:
------------------------------------

Some inheritance configurations must specify property "jdo.tck.requiredOptio
ns" as shown below:

- inheritance1.conf: javax.jdo.option.mapping.JoinedTablePerClass.
- inheritance2.conf: javax.jdo.option.mapping.NonJoinedTablePerConcreteClass
, javax.jdo.option.mapping.RelationSubclassTable.
- inheritance3.conf: javax.jdo.option.mapping.JoinedTablePerConcreteClass, j
avax.jdo.option.mapping.RelationSubclassTable.

> The inheritance3 test should check whether PMF.supportedOptions contains "javax.jd
o.option.mapping.RelationSubclassTable" before running the test. JPOX doesn't suppor
t this option yet the test still runs (and fails)
